Mumbai: Legendary actor Dilip Kumar, who was hospitalised due to high fever and chest infection, is recovering well and his reports are 'normal,' confirmed a representative of his wife Saira Banu.

Dilip saab was taken to Lilavati Hospital in Bandra on Saturday around 2-2.30 am, hospital sources said.

"Dilip sir is recovering well and all his reports are also normal. He will be discharged from the hospital in a couple of days," Saira ji's representative told IANS.

Dilip saab, who married actress Saira Banu in 1966, is well-known for playing tragic heroes in films like Andaz, Baabul, Mela, Deedar and Jogan. He was last seen in 1998 film Qila.

Dilip Kumar's many awards include the Padma Vibhushan, which he received in 2015. He was honoured with the Padma Bhushan in 1991 and the Dadasaheb Phalke Award in 1994. He was the first winner of the Filmfare Best Actor award - for 1956's Azaad - and shares the record for the most wins - eight - with Shah Rukh Khan.
